Value propositionis a promise of value to bedelivered to your client.

Poor VPSimple fix for Dell laptops.Why?A lot of companies fix Dell laptops and that’s not unique.
Effective VPWe fix Dell laptops in just one hour.Why?You sell speed of fixing that no one else can propose.
You should sell experience, not a product itself.
Poor VPOur pizza is the tastest.Why?Every pizza pretends to have the best taste.
Effective VPYou get hot pizza delivered under 30 min – or it’s free!Why?You sell super-fast delivery, not simply a pizza.
I pay for experience, not for the product.

Geoff Moore’s VP—For … (target customer),—who … (need),—our … (product)—is … (product category)—that … (benefit).
VP exampleFor non-designers who have a need to create cards, posters, presentations and emails our product is a web-based layout software that has 3500 fully editable templates.
Venture Hacks’ Pitch—… (prominent example)—for … (new domain).
VP examples(We are) Google for antique clocks.(Our service is) Pinterest of engineering innovations.
Steve Blank’s XYZ—We help X (target users)—to do Y (need)—doing Z (method).
VP examplesWe help managers to increase productivity automating task-assigning process.We help web developers check UI specification by clicking on a mockup.
When a company has no clear value proposition
Vlaskovits & Cooper’s CPS—Client: who?—Problem: what?—Solution: how?
VP exampleClient: medium-sized startups.Problem: complicated process of ROI calculation.Solution: low-cost analytics system for non-technical marketers.
David Cowan's Pitchcraft—Problem scale.—Product.—Differentiation.—Credibility.
VP exampleOne person dies of melanoma every 62 min. We offer a dermatoscope iPhone app that enables people to diagnose their skin. The technology is patented and trusted by the World Health Organization.
Eric Sink’s VP—The most … (superlative)—… (label)—for … (qualifiers).
VP examplesThe most secure payment gateway for mobile e-commerce.The easiest food delivery service for office workers.
Guy Kawasaki’s VAD—Verb.—Application.—Differentiator.
VP examplesShare PowerPoint and Keynote slides including audio.Make a high-fidelity prototype in just an hour.

Business model is an abstract depictionof an organization, its corearrangements, productsand strategic goals.

Value proposition—Product benefits.—Promo messages.
Value architecture—Technological structure.—Organizational design.
Value network—Set of clients.—Partner interaction.
Value finance—Costing.—Pricing methods.—Revenue structure.
Famous BMs—Direct sales.—Franchise.—Value-added reseller.—Auction.—Pay what you can.—Pyramid scheme.
